The garage occupancy feed for the Brindlewood campus arrives over a message queue every thirty seconds, one record per level, published by the Stallgrid edge boxes. Counts can briefly go negative when a sensor double-fires on exit; the ingest job clamps these to zero and flags the interval. If the feed stalls for more than five minutes, the dashboard falls back to the last known snapshot. Sensor mappings, queue names, and the replay procedure are documented on the internal page below.

runbook for tahog-kadug: https://gitlab.qirvanworks.corp/projects/pages/view/b139298aed28

Handover note — Crumbwheel order cutoffs.

Welcome aboard. The bakery cutoff rule in Crumbwheel closes same-day orders at 14:00 local to each storefront, not UTC — this has bitten us twice. Holiday overrides live in the calendar service and take precedence silently, so always check there first when a cutoff looks wrong. To unlock the calendar service's admin console after a restart, enter the recovery passphrase below.

vault phrase of bagap-bahaf = silion-pelox-sorox-casdor-quenwyn-fraax-eliox-praael-kelion-quenvan-kasox-rusael-norius-belvan

Building Access — Interview Room (Secure), Level 3

Room 3.12 at Dunmarley House is the designated secure interview room. Keep it locked at all times. Candidates must be escorted; no unaccompanied access. Recording equipment stays inside the room. Cleaning is Fridays only, supervised by Facilities. Badge access is restricted to the hiring team and Facilities staff. If a badge fails, use the backup keypad by the door frame. The current keypad code is below.

staff pass of kawip-hawef = bdg-QLP-2

# Digestron — Environments

Digestron schedules batch email digests for all Quillmarsh tenants. Three environments: dev, staging, prod. Dev runs digests every 10 minutes against a mail sink; nothing leaves the cluster. Staging mirrors prod schedules but routes to the Hollowtide test inbox. Prod fires tenant digests on cron windows pinned to tenant timezones; never change prod cron without a change ticket. Scheduler state lives in the Fenwick store, one row per tenant. Environment-specific values differ only in the following settings.

config for tagep-yajef:
ulawyn:
  log_level: error
  metrics_host: metrics.ulawyn.lumiclabs.internal
  pin: 0564
  pool_size: 32